Remembering Falls Mob Boss

While Niagara Falls, New York was losing tourist attractions over the winter of 2007-2008,
The Mob Tours
was gearing up to take their place. This Saturday, July 19, 2008, the organized crime tour company will remember former Niagara Falls/Buffalo mob boss Stefano "the Undertaker" Magaddino on the 24th anniversary of his death. "Dress Like a Mobster Day is a way to remember the anniversary of his death," stated founder Mike "Lefty" Rizzo, "without actually glorifying it. It will be a fitting way to highlight a historical day in Niagara Falls history, for after Magaddino died, the mob power moved to Buffalo."
"Dress Like a Mobster Day"
starts at 10:00AM in front of the Daredevil Museum, 303 Rainbow Blvd. All contestants will be judged for their originality and costume, and will receive a discount pass for the tour. The winner will receive two free passes and a t-shirt to The Mob Tours, as well as a gift certificate to Magaddino's favorite restaurant.
Mob Museum
One of the stops on The Mob Tours is Little Italy Niagara, a small mafia museum on 19th Street. While Las Vegas is planning on building a museum dedicated to organized crime, Niagara Falls already has one. Rizzo explained: "They have been building their collection over the years and have multiple items telling the history of Magaddino and the Niagara Falls mob. It's a great addition to our tour and the people love it. While the Vegas museum won't open for two more years, we have a real one right here, and it's part of our tour."
Sopranos Actor
Actor Joseph R. Gannascoli, best known for his role as Vito Spatafore in Sopranos, has agreed to allow his name and likeness to be used for promotional purposes for The Mob Tours. "Having Mr. Gannascoli help us out at this juncture is a fantastic opportunity and we truly appreciate his support," stated Rizzo. Gannascoli also appeared in Goodfellas, Blowfish and has written a novel.
